Nice 3-plex in great condition, well taken care of complex. The front house is a freestanding 1500 sqft 3 bed 2 bath home with a front and back yard. At the back of the lot there are two bed, one bath up and down apartments. There are long time tenants occupying now. Units are very easy to the rent, the rents are low and there is an opportunity to increase. It's separately metered for gas and electric. Close to schools, shopping, ZOO, public transportation and other amenities.
